Here is a wonderful quote from our first prophet Brother Joseph Smith.

The Saviour said, . . . "Blessed are ye when men shall revile you, and persecute you, and shall say all manner of evil against you falsely for my sake; rejoice and be exceeding glad, for great is your reward in heaven, for so persecuted they the Prophets which were before you." Now, dear brethren, if any men ever had reason to claim this promise, we are the men; for we know that the world not only hate us, but they speak all manner of evil of us falsely, for no other reason than that we have been endeavouring to teach the fullness of the Gospel of Jesus Christ. Teachings of the Prophet Joseph Smith,
